Advanced Monitoring and Detection

Money laundering can take many forms, from simple transactions to complex schemes involving multiple players AML iGaming software is equipped with advanced monitoring and detection capabilities that can identify suspicious transactions, patterns, and behaviors in real-time.

By analyzing data from multiple sources, such as transaction histories, customer profiles, and external databases, AML software can flag potentially fraudulent activities and trigger alerts for further investigation This proactive approach allows operators to detect and prevent money laundering before it occurs, reducing their exposure to financial crime and regulatory penalties.

Enhanced Customer Due Diligence

One of the key components of AML compliance is customer due diligence (CDD), which requires businesses to verify and monitor the identities of their customers aml igaming software. AML iGaming software streamlines the CDD process by automating identity verification, risk assessment, and ongoing monitoring of customer accounts.

By integrating data from multiple sources, such as government databases, credit bureaus, and watchlists, AML software can verify the identities of customers in real-time and assign risk scores based on their profiles This information allows operators to categorize customers according to their risk level and apply appropriate due diligence measures to mitigate potential threats.
